Frequently Asked Questions

Is this transfer available for groups larger than 10?
No, the service is limited to groups of up to 10 people. Larger groups may need to arrange multiple vehicles.
Does the price of $100 include gratuity?
Gratuity is not included but is customary if you feel the driver provided excellent service.
Can I cancel this transfer if my flight is delayed?
Yes, you can cancel free of charge up to 24 hours in advance, which gives flexibility if your plans change.
Is the transfer door-to-door?
Yes, the driver will drop you off at your hotel lobby or Airbnb, making this a direct, private service.
Are there options for round-trip transfers?
The service described is for one-way only. You may need to book a separate transfer for your return.
What if I have special needs or mobility issues?
Service animals are allowed, but it’s best to inform the provider in advance to accommodate any specific requirements.
Does the transfer include any stops along the way?
No, stops for grocery shopping or other errands are not included.
Are beverages available on the vehicle?
Bottled water is included, and alcoholic beverages may be available, depending on the driver.
How long does the transfer usually take?
Typically about 20-30 minutes, depending on traffic and your hotel’s location.
What happens if my flight is canceled or delayed?
Notify the provider as soon as possible. The cancellation policy allows free cancellation up to 24 hours before your scheduled pickup.
